Gas Chromotography
Variety of field portable detectors gas chromatograph and mass spectrometers for express detection of Toxic Industrial Chemicals (TICs), Explosives, Chemical Warfare Agents (CWAs) and Narcotics in Aqueous, Vapor, and Aerosol Samples.

Applications: In-field detection of Explosives, Security, Emergency Response to toxic spills, Law Enforcement
Polycapillary Chromatographic Columns (PCC)
Coiled and Straight Gas Multicapillary Column (PCC) is a monolithic bundle of about one thousand 40µm ID capillaries coated with immobilised liquid phases. The columns could be used for express separation of organic compounds in any gas chromatograph.
At operating temperature range of 30 – 230 °C we provide a broad range of liquid stationary phases: SE-30, SE-54, OV-61, SKTFT-50X, Carbowax 20M, etc.
Carrier gas flow rate: 40 – 200 ml/min
Efficiency: (9-14).103 t.p.
Time of separation: 20 – 300 s
Sample volume: 1 ml (gas phase) or 1 µl (liquid phase)
